H. K. Dai is a scholar working on Computer Networks and Communications,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Artificial Intelligence. According to data from OpenAlex, H. K. Dai has authored 18 papers receiving a total of 347 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 10 papers in Computer Networks and Communications, 6 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 4 papers in Artificial Intelligence. Recurrent topics in H. K. Dai's work include Interconnection Networks and Systems (4 papers), Optimization and Search Problems (3 papers) and Advanced Memory and Neural Computing (3 papers). H. K. Dai is often cited by papers focused on Interconnection Networks and Systems (4 papers), Optimization and Search Problems (3 papers) and Advanced Memory and Neural Computing (3 papers). H. K. Dai collaborates with scholars based in United States and Vietnam. H. K. Dai's co-authors include Modan K. Das, Iker Gondra, Jin Hwan Park, Michel Toulouse, Terry Anderson, Yuanqi Du and Zidong Wang and has published in prestigious journals such as BMC Bioinformatics, Journal of Computer and System Sciences and The Journal of Supercomputing.
